Massive Arms Seizure in Manipur: 155 Weapons, 1652 Ammunition Rounds Recovered
A joint operation by Manipur Police and the Assam Rifles resulted in the seizure of a significant cache of weapons and ammunition in Manipur. The operation, part of a coordinated search across the state's hill districts, yielded 155 weapons and 1,652 rounds of ammunition.
In addition to the firearms and ammunition, security forces recovered four binoculars, fifteen communication sets, and a telescope. Inspector General of Police (IGP) Ningshen Worngan held a press conference in Imphal to announce the details of the successful operation, highlighting the importance of the seizure in maintaining security in the region.
The operation underscores the ongoing efforts to curb illegal arms proliferation in the state.
